Club Receives Letter of Thanks

July 1, 2018News RHG Articles

Over the past few months several club members helped Ray WA9BLP restore his antenna tower and station to working order. You can read more about it in Giving a Helping Hand to a HAM in need and Ray WA9BLP Antenna Project Update. Dirk W0RI organized the group and recently received the following note of thanks from Ray’s Wife.
